Indigenous Plant Selection
Opting for native plant species offers Seattle homeowners an eco-friendly approach to landscaping by optimizing ecological balance and sustainability. By incorporating local plant varieties such as sword ferns, Oregon grape, and red-flowering currant, you secure your landscape performs effectively in the Pacific Northwest's particular climate and soil conditions. Native plant benefits feature lower maintenance requirements, improved drought hardiness, and improved support for regional wildlife and pollinators. These species naturally fight off local pests and diseases, minimizing the need for chemical applications. When planning your site, focus on plant communities that echo natural ecosystems, promoting biodiversity and soil health. Incorporating native plant selections develops visually harmonious, functional landscapes that flourish with minimal resource input—connecting your outdoor space with sustainable best practices designed for Seattle's unique environment.

Organic Mulching Practices
Among the most successful sustainable landscaping methods for Seattle homeowners centers on the thoughtful implementation of organic mulches. When choosing site-appropriate mulch types—such as shredded bark, wood chips, or compost—you'll enhance soil health, reduce weeds, and moderate soil temperature, all vital for Seattle's temperate and rainy climate. Focus on locally sourced materials to minimize transportation emissions and guarantee compatibility with native plantings.
Apply mulch uniformly over planting beds, maintaining a depth of two to four inches, and place material a few inches away from plant stems to prevent rot. Regularly add mulch to ensure ideal coverage, specifically after heavy rain. Adjusting your mulching techniques to Seattle's unique soil and precipitation patterns improves moisture retention, decreases erosion, and creates a hardy, low-maintenance landscape.

Seasonal Lawn Care and Maintenance Services
A vibrant landscape in Seattle demands specialized care to address the local persistent moisture, mild climate, and moss growth. It's essential to have a structured approach to year-round maintenance that considers both environmental and aesthetic factors. Start each year with focused lawn aeration to alleviate soil compaction from winter rainfall, promoting deeper root development and optimal grass vitality. Incorporate seasonal planting of regionally adapted grass blends and shade-resistant groundcovers to enhance year-round appearance and feel. Routine dethatching and adjusted mowing schedules help manage moss and prevent fungal issues typical of Seattle's climate. Fertilize with formulations matched to the soil's nutrient profile, adjusting for spring and fall growth cycles. This comprehensive regimen assures your landscape remains practical, visually appealing, and sustainable throughout the year.

Preventing Landscape Water Damage
While Seattle landscapes thrive with abundant rainfall, unmanaged water can quickly undermine even the most carefully designed outdoor spaces. It's essential to address water flow with tailored drainage solutions appropriate for your property's gradients and planting zones. Techniques like French drains, permeable pavers, and bioswales direct runoff away from foundations and high-traffic areas, safeguarding structural and aesthetic integrity. Proper drainage not only prevents pooling and erosion but further enhances long-term soil health by minimizing compaction and root rot risks. Consider adding rain gardens or dry creek beds, which both manage stormwater and improve visual appeal. By proactively managing water movement, you'll safeguard your landscape investment while supporting sustainability.
